Exploring Patagonia's Natural Wonders

Patagonia is home to some of the most breathtaking natural wonders in South America. My personal experience was visiting the Perito Moreno Glacier, which was an incredible sight to behold. The glacier is massive, and the sound of ice cracking and falling into the water is unforgettable. Other popular natural attractions include the Torres del Paine National Park, the Fitz Roy Peak, and the Tierra del Fuego National Park.

Patagonia's Rich Cultural Heritage

Patagonia has a rich cultural heritage that dates back thousands of years. The region's indigenous people, such as the Mapuche and the Tehuelche, have a unique history and culture that is worth exploring. Additionally, Patagonia has a strong European influence, particularly from Spanish and Welsh settlers. You can experience this cultural blend through food, music, and art.

Patagonia's Local Cuisine

Patagonian cuisine is a unique blend of indigenous and European flavors. The region's famous dishes include lamb, empanadas, and mate, a traditional hot beverage. You can also experience the local culture through wine and craft beer tastings.

FAQs

What is the best time to visit Patagonia?

The best time to visit Patagonia is during the summer months between December and February. The weather is mild, and the days are longer, providing more time for outdoor activities.

Do I need a visa to visit Patagonia?

It depends on your nationality. Citizens of some countries may require a visa to enter Argentina or Chile, which are the two countries that make up Patagonia. Check with the respective embassies for more information.

What should I pack for a trip to Patagonia?

Pack comfortable and warm clothing, as the weather can be unpredictable. Additionally, bring sturdy hiking shoes, sunscreen, and insect repellent.

Are there any safety concerns for travelers in Patagonia?

Patagonia is generally a safe destination for travelers. However, it is always advisable to take precautions, such as avoiding isolated areas and keeping an eye on your belongings.
